Output 77cf6e425c107619e11501accd01b6414d4699f1f11bf05364e7c1f1748a248b:1

value
11179968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4963c005612b22e016a2300ac157df05906450e OP_EQUAL
address
3M559gNCfzr9SjFPcWAqQLatWXxU8kLQes
transaction
77cf6e425c107619e11501accd01b6414d4699f1f11bf05364e7c1f1748a248b
confirmations
264099
spent
true